Product Overview

A unique blend of two adaptogenic herbs. NooGhanda® is a premium quality Ashwagandha extract that has been traditionally used in Ayurvedic Medicine to help the body adapt to stress. This form of Ashwagandha utilises Liposomal technology, an innovative encapsulation system designed to promote optimal absorption and uptake within the body. Holixer™ is an extract of the Holy Basil herb, which helps to relieve symptoms of stress.
